摘要
An attempt is made to elucidate the mechanism of partial discharge (PD) occurring in the CIGRE Method II (CM-II) electrode system, which is a representative closed-void model system. We developed a computer-aided PD measuring system. This allows us to obtain phase information of all PD pulses, together with their amplitudes, so that a statistical analysis of these data can be discussed. Measurements of PD are made for the CM-II electrode system. Effects of the pressure and gas inside the void on the PD are examined. Taking into account the experimental results, we propose a model for the PD mechanism. This model assumes that the statistical time lag of discharge depends on the overvoltage and that the residual voltage depends on the PD magnitude. A Monte Carlo simulation of the PD distribution is made on the basis of this model. The computed results agree well with the experimental data and the appearance of swarming pulsive micro discharges. The physics of the model also are discussed. © 1990 IEEE
